Add support to device_add foo-x86_64-cpu, and additional checks of
apic id are added into x86_cpuid_set_apic_id() to avoid duplicate.
Besides, in order to support "device/device_add foo-x86_64-cpu"
which without specified apic id, we assign cpuid_apic_id with a
default broadcast value (0xFFFFFFFF) in initfn, and a new function
get_free_apic_id() to provide a free apid id to cpuid_apic_id if
it still has the default at realize time (e.g. hot add foo-cpu without
a specified apic id) to avoid apic id duplicates.

+/* Calculate CPU topology based on CPU APIC ID.
+ */
+static inline void x86_topo_ids_from_apic_id(unsigned nr_cores,
+ unsigned nr_threads,
+ apic_id_t apic_id,
+ X86CPUTopoInfo *topo)
+{
+ unsigned offset_mask;
+ topo->pkg_id = apic_id >> apicid_pkg_offset(nr_cores, nr_threads);
+
+ offset_mask = (1L << apicid_pkg_offset(nr_cores, nr_threads)) - 1;
+ topo->core_id = (apic_id & offset_mask)
+ >> apicid_core_offset(nr_cores, nr_threads);
+
+ offset_mask = (1L << apicid_core_offset(nr_cores, nr_threads)) - 1;
+ topo->smt_id = apic_id & offset_mask;
+}
